in a survey of 2542 adults in a recent year, 1301 say they have made a new years resolution. construct 90% and 95% confidence intervals for the population proportion. interpret the results and compare the widths of the confidence intervals. the 90% confidence interval for the population proportion p is (0.496, 0.528) (round to three decimal places as needed.) the 95% confidence interval for the population proportion p is (round to three decimal places as needed.)

Explanation:

Step1: Calculate sample proportion $\hat{p}$

Sample proportion $\hat{p}=\frac{x}{n}$, where $x = 1301$ (number of successes) and $n=2542$ (sample size).
$\hat{p}=\frac{1301}{2542}\approx0.512$

Step2: Calculate $q$

Since $q = 1-\hat{p}$, then $q=1 - 0.512=0.488$

Step3: Find $z$-values

For a 95% confidence interval, the critical value $z_{\alpha/2}$:
The significance level $\alpha=1 - 0.95=0.05$, so $\alpha/2=0.025$. From the standard normal distribution table, $z_{0.025}=1.96$

Step4: Calculate the margin of error $E$

The formula for the margin of error for a proportion is $E = z_{\alpha/2}\sqrt{\frac{\hat{p}q}{n}}$
Substitute $\hat{p}=0.512$, $q = 0.488$, $n = 2542$, and $z_{\alpha/2}=1.96$
$E=1.96\sqrt{\frac{0.512\times0.488}{2542}}$
First, calculate $0.512\times0.488 = 0.250$
Then $\sqrt{\frac{0.250}{2542}}\approx\sqrt{0.0000983}\approx0.010$
$E=1.96\times0.010 = 0.020$

Step5: Calculate the confidence interval

The confidence interval for a proportion is $\hat{p}-ESubstitute $\hat{p}=0.512$ and $E = 0.020$
$0.512-0.020=0.492$ and $0.512 + 0.020=0.532$

Answer:

The 95% confidence interval for the population proportion $p$ is $(0.492,0.532)$
